Technical Specifications Deep-Dive: Material Selection, Base Engineering, and Structural Standards

Carbon Composite vs. Aluminum: The Real Performance Gap

Many buyers default to aluminum for banner stands. The most common alloy is 6063-T5, sometimes 6061-T6. Without a temper and surface finish callout, the spec is incomplete. ASTM B221 governs extruded aluminum bars, rods, and profiles. Request only “aluminum” and you might get a soft T4 temper, prone to bending. It's that simple. Even with T6, repeated wind cycles cause micro-yielding. Over a season, the stand develops a permanent lean. Mike measured a 4° tilt after just two outdoor events. That stand was scrapped within 60 days.

The carbon composite Tornado Banner behaves differently. It deflects, then returns to its original geometry. Our in-house cyclic test—1,200 load cycles at simulated 30-knot gusts—showed no residual deformation in the carbon frames. Every aluminum sample failed by cycle 600.

Weight matters for freight, not just portability. A single Tornado Banner frame weighs 1.530 kg. A typical aluminum 3D flag pole of comparable height (2.2 m) weighs 2.4–2.8 kg. That extra kilogram, multiplied by 1,258 units in a 40HQ container, adds 1,258 kg of payload. Freight class shifts when density changes. For LCL shipments, the chargeable weight often jumps.

Table 1: Carbon Composite vs. Aluminum 3D Banner Stand (2.2 m Display Height)

Attribute Carbon Composite (Tornado Banner) Aluminum 6063-T5
Frame weight 1.530 kg 2.5 kg (typical)
Rust resistance 100% rust-proof Anodized, pitting possible in chlorides
Fatigue behavior Elastic recovery; no permanent set Micro-yielding; progressive lean
40HQ container load ~1,258 units ~850 units (bulkier collapsed volume)
HTS classification (US) 6603.90.8100 (other articles of carbon fibers) 7616.99.5190 (other aluminum articles)
Base weight trade-off Lighter base possible (31 cm cross base, 2 kg water tank) Heavier base required to offset top weight

Base Weight: Stability, Freight Class, and the Dunnage Factor

A heavier base improves wind resistance. But base weight cuts both ways. Our cross base with water tank adds 2 kg when filled, yet the base itself is polyethylene—light and stackable. For permanent outdoor installation, a steel spike is available. Base weight directly impacts freight class and container utilization. Using NMFC density-based classification, display stands fall under class 125 if density is below 1 pcf, class 100 if 1–2 pcf, and so on. Pack the unfilled base and carbon composite pole as a compact package (158 × 18 × 19 cm), and you hit a shipping density that lands in class 100 or better. Compare that with an aluminum set that requires a heavier steel base plate—often a separate SKU. The consolidated shipment can drop to class 150, raising freight cost per unit 20–35%.

ASTM Compliance: The Specification that Prevents Field Failure

A spec without a published standard is incomplete. Our carbon composite poles are tested for flexural modulus per ASTM D790 and compressive strength per ASTM D695. Those are analogous to the structural checks on aluminum per ASTM B308 (standard specification for 6061-T6 aluminum-alloy structural pipe and tube). When your supplier provides a certificate of conformance, verify that it lists the test method and the temper or resin system—not just “composite.” That step saved one of our importers from a CBP hold. The officer questioned the material declaration; the documentation resolved it. The package should include a detailed product data sheet, batch test results, and a RoHS compliance statement if destined for the EU.

Supply Chain Resilience: Import Compliance, Inventory Strategy, and Supplier Assessment

Import Compliance: Documentation That Prevents Customs Holds

Carbon composite products fall under a different HTS subheading than aluminum. That can be an advantage. US HTS 6603.90.8100 for “articles of carbon fibers” carries a lower duty rate than the 7616.99.5190 aluminum articles rate. But the classification must be defended. A valid entry requires correct country of origin, a detailed product description, and often a lab analysis confirming material composition. We provide a product specification sheet with HS code recommendations for US, EU, and AU markets. For EU importers, the carbon composite’s lack of metal simplifies REACH and RoHS compliance: no electroplating, no heavy metals. With aluminum, CBP may request a lab test to confirm alloy composition. That can delay clearance by two weeks.

Internal audits matter. Every quarter, we review a sample of entries to ensure valuation methods are consistent and any assists are properly declared. One importer misclassified the aluminum banner base as a separate item, triggering a higher duty because the base was considered “other base metal mountings.” Correcting the entry—classifying the complete set as a display stand of the principal material—reduced duty by 1.8 percentage points. Across a containerload, those details add up.

Inventory Buffer Strategies for Seasonal Demand Cycles

Trade shows and retail promotions follow a distinct seasonal curve: Q1 launch events, Q3 holiday prep, with spikes in Q2 and Q4 for specific industries. Demand can shift 40% month to month. We recommend a buffer stock policy linked to lead time variability. Our average production lead time is 25 days, standard deviation 7 days. For a distributor needing 30-day lead time, a safety stock covering 14 days of forecast demand handles 95% of variability without excessive carrying cost. Because 1,258 units fit in a 40HQ container, a European distributor can settle into a rhythm: one container every 6–8 weeks during peak season. The carbon composite’s lower replacement frequency means buffer stock lasts longer, reducing the bullwhip effect upstream.
